The Georgia seal, in it's current form has been used since 1914 to certify government documents. Apart from the motto, Justice, Wisdom and Moderation, it contains a Roman arch that is a symbol for the State's constitution.
Each column of this arch represents the three branches of government i.e. executive, judicial an legislative. Between the second and third column, the figure of a man can be seen with sword in his hand.
This represents the Georgian locals defending their State's constitution
